Re: Steve Wiebe to attempt new world record of classic arcade game Donkey Kong

DudeBro I completely disagree. Donkey Kong is all about skill. (And a little luck too.) There are tricks you can do to help you along the way. (Controlling barrels, controlling what side a fireball appears.)

The rest is all skill, and there are many risks along the way the top Donkey Kong players take that allow them to get million plus scores before the kill screen. When you take those risks it is your skills that will allow you to survive.

That being said, I am afraid this has been played out. People like me who respect the skill required to play this game are interested, but the general gaming population has moved on.
